Transaction 4fc76848301b23c90d3dbe86acb1581908e3b7a32c2a54dbdfdcd6e2664c8491

1 Input
2 Outputs
  • 4fc76848301b23c90d3dbe86acb1581908e3b7a32c2a54dbdfdcd6e2664c8491:0
  • value  1289510996
    address  32fGKyaJFaSSZvyzgQugut4nc1S73YxFhS
  • 4fc76848301b23c90d3dbe86acb1581908e3b7a32c2a54dbdfdcd6e2664c8491:1
  • value  60000000
    address  16FMQSEHAYRxU1cssgczDzZSHmKNwXcePA